Create a Flexible and Honest Summer Budget



Begin by taking a look at your existing monthly costs and readjusting for seasonal differences. Factor in points like household trips, itinerary, and raised energy use. Be straightforward about what your household has a tendency to invest this moment of year and where you might need to shift funds to keep whatever well balanced.



If you prepare to take a trip, establish a strong investing limitation beforehand, consisting of accommodations, dishes, gas, and entertainment. For staycations, identify neighborhood free or inexpensive events that can offer the same feeling of journey without the added expense. Greeley is rich with area events, outside shows, and parks that can turn a regular weekend break right into an unforgettable one.

Taking Care Of Summer Activities Without Overspending



Youngsters are home much more, which typically implies even more enjoyment costs. One way to extend your dollars is by intending ahead. Look for neighborhood programs, collection events, or summer season reading obstacles that are both enhancing and free.



Dish preparation likewise helps in reducing the propensity to overspend on dining in a restaurant. Also a couple of added home-cooked meals a week can amount to significant cost savings over the summer season. Involving youngsters in the dish planning or food preparation can additionally turn it into a fun, shared activity.



If your kids are old sufficient, urge summer season jobs or tasks that include a tiny allocation. It teaches responsibility and allows them to experience the value of budgeting their very own cash for tiny desires or requires.
